10 THINGS I KNOW ABOUT YOU
With Simon Taylor
2011 Melbourne Fringe Festival Review



































Simon Taylor would easily have to be one of the best performers I've seen. When you see Simon Taylor, you're not just watching a comedian, you're getting the whole performance package complete with singing, dancing and even a little bit of magic.
But what's most intriguing is his comedy.
His fascination with the human mind has given him a complex understanding of human behaviour which is highlighted in this show 10 Things I Know About You. Covering topics like love and morality, not only does he give some insight into the methods behind human madness, but he keeps it relevant and, even more importantly, he keeps it funny.
His energy and charisma on stage almost reminded me of a US talk show (except that he also managed to have interesting and intellectual content).
His endearing nature made him seem at times a little more vulnerable, enabling him to connect with the audience on a deeper level.
His grasp of language, timing and character kept the audience engaged and laughing while his content kept us intrigued.
As the aspects of his show were so varied in content and performance style, it's difficult to isolate any particular highlights, but my own personal favourite would have been his love song based on physiological processes of the mind and body.
Keep an eye out for Simon Taylor, it won't be long before he's gracing bigger stages.
